A drive-thru lane usually shows equipment problems before the dining room does. Orders get repeated, cars stack up, staff start leaning out the window, and ticket times creep higher one headset transmission at a time. Choosing the best drive thru communication equipment is less about buying a single headset system and more about building a setup that stays clear, stable, and serviceable during peak volume.

For quick-service operators, franchise groups, and installers, the right system has to do three things well. It needs to deliver intelligible audio in a noisy environment, hold up through long operating hours, and fit the rest of the restaurant hardware stack without creating sourcing gaps. That is where equipment selection matters.

What actually defines the best drive thru communication equipment

The best systems are not always the most feature-heavy. In many stores, the right choice is the system that keeps crew communication consistent through lunch rush, handles weather exposure, and can be repaired or expanded without replacing the entire lane.

Audio clarity comes first. Wind, truck engines, kitchen exhaust, and multiple speakers talking at once can make a technically functional system feel unusable. Noise reduction, microphone quality, speaker tuning, and lane detection all affect whether an order is captured correctly the first time.

Reliability is next. A headset that sounds good on day one but fails batteries, chargers, or ear pads every few months creates hidden operating costs. For multi-unit operators, standardized components matter because replacement cycles become easier to manage.

Then there is compatibility. A drive-thru system is not isolated hardware. It often sits beside timers, POS workflows, order confirmation, networking gear, surge protection, and power accessories. Buyers who only source the visible parts often end up waiting on adapters, mounts, interface pieces, or replacement power supplies.

Core components in the best drive thru communication equipment setup

A complete system usually includes more than most first-time buyers expect. Headsets are the visible piece, but lane performance depends on several components working together.

Headsets and beltpacks

This is the part staff use all day, so comfort and durability matter as much as sound. Lightweight units reduce fatigue during long shifts, but lighter is not always better if it comes at the cost of structural durability. For high-volume stores, rechargeable models are usually the practical choice, provided the charging routine is consistent and spare batteries or extra charging positions are available.

Single-ear versus dual-ear is situational. Single-ear headsets let staff stay aware of kitchen and counter activity. Dual-ear models can improve focus in very loud environments. Stores with heavy ambient noise often benefit from better isolation, while stores that rely on constant face-to-face crew coordination may prefer a more open design.

Base stations and lane interface hardware

The base station handles signal management, lane assignment, and communication routing. This is where many system limitations show up. If a site runs multiple lanes, dedicated lane support and fast switching matter. If a store has expansion plans, the base should support added headsets and future accessories without forcing a full replacement.

A stable base installation also depends on proper power, mounting, cable management, and environmental protection. Weak installation practices can make good equipment perform badly.

Speaker posts, microphones, and vehicle detection

Outdoor audio hardware takes the most environmental abuse. Rain, heat, cold, road dust, and impact risk all shorten service life. The microphone and speaker assembly at the menu board must remain intelligible despite these conditions. If either side degrades, staff compensate by repeating themselves, which slows the lane.

Vehicle detection is easy to overlook until it starts missing cars or triggering inconsistently. Accurate detection helps with staff awareness and timer reporting. If your operation tracks speed of service closely, dependable loop detection or equivalent sensing hardware matters more than it may seem during procurement.

Batteries, chargers, and replacement parts

A communication system is only as available as its battery inventory. Stores that run too few charged spares often blame the headset system when the real issue is charging discipline. Commercial chargers, replacement batteries, ear cushions, clips, and hygiene items should be treated as standard operational stock, not occasional extras.

How to compare the best drive thru communication equipment for your store

The right comparison starts with site conditions, not brand names. A suburban single-lane coffee concept has different needs than a dual-lane burger location with late-night traffic and high crew turnover.

First, look at throughput. Higher car counts usually justify better noise handling, more headset positions, and stronger battery rotation. If your operation regularly runs multiple order takers or lane coordinators, capacity and channel management need close review.

Second, assess the physical environment. Nearby roads, truck traffic, weather exposure, and speaker placement all affect audio performance. A site with constant environmental noise may need more aggressive noise-canceling and better lane hardware than a quieter location.

Third, think about serviceability. Some systems are easier to maintain because replacement accessories and consumables are readily available. Others work well until one small component fails and the location is left waiting. For restaurant operators, uptime often matters more than having the newest feature set.

Fourth, consider operational training. Advanced features only help if crews use them correctly. A simpler system that new staff can learn quickly may outperform a more complex one in a busy quick-service environment.

Common trade-offs buyers should expect

There is no perfect system for every store. Most decisions involve trade-offs.

Wireless freedom is valuable, but wireless systems depend on battery discipline and interference control. Wired positions can reduce mobility but sometimes offer predictable performance in fixed-use scenarios.

Higher noise isolation can improve order accuracy, but it may also reduce crew awareness of nearby activity. That can matter in stores where one employee shifts between headset duty, front counter, and window service.

Premium hardware usually lasts longer and performs better under pressure, but the better buying decision depends on lane volume and replacement strategy. A lower-cost setup may be acceptable for modest traffic, while high-volume stores usually benefit from investing in equipment built for heavier use.

Installation matters as much as the equipment itself

A large share of drive-thru communication problems come from installation details rather than defective hardware. Power quality, grounding, cable routing, connector condition, and weatherproofing all affect reliability. Outdoor components need proper sealing and secure mounting. Interior equipment needs stable power and organized cabling.

Best drive thru communication equipment for multi-unit operators

For multi-unit groups, standardization often matters more than chasing incremental feature differences. Using the same headset platform, battery type, charger configuration, and replacement part inventory across locations simplifies support. Training becomes easier. Spare stock becomes more useful. Service calls become faster to diagnose.

It also helps to define a replacement plan instead of reacting to failure. Headsets, batteries, ear pads, and chargers all have service lives. Replacing these on a schedule is usually less disruptive than waiting for the lunch rush to expose the weak point.

If your team supports many sites, document the complete lane bill of materials, not just the main headset SKU. Include power accessories, interface pieces, mounting hardware, lane audio components, and consumables. That record saves time when a location needs urgent replacement.

When to replace instead of repair

Not every audio issue calls for a full system change. If the problem is isolated to batteries, chargers, ear pads, microphones, or outdoor speaker assemblies, targeted replacement may restore performance quickly. But if a system has recurring audio dropouts, poor part availability, or repeated failures across multiple components, replacement becomes easier to justify.

Aging systems can also create soft costs. Longer order times, staff frustration, and repeated customer corrections may not appear on an equipment invoice, but they affect sales throughput. If communication quality is clearly limiting lane speed, waiting too long to upgrade can cost more than the hardware.
